Key Duties and Responsibilities:

Assigned to the GSO Property section performing general appliances and equipment repairs at the Warehouse, Chancery and leased residential properties.

Maintenance and repairs duties

  • Performs highly skilled full journeyman level works for residential and office equipment.
  • Responsible for correct repair, maintenance, modifications and installation of appliances, equipment and associated accessories.
  • Independently, identifies repair problems, takes corrective action in the repair and installation of appliance/office equipment.
  • Repairs and maintains appliances such as clothes washer, dryer, freezer refrigerators vacuum cleaners, electric kettle and stove by changing power plugs, cords, fuses.
  • Examines appliances for mechanical defects i.e., broken belts, castors, missing accessories/components prior to installation and replaces defective parts such as power cords, plugs, fuses, burners, drive assemblies, ensuring all appliances/equipment are effectively earthed to US Mission safety requirements and specifications, does comprehensive appliances/equipment test before delivery.
  • Must be cognizant and abide by embassy safety and health practices.

Other Duties:

  • Performs miscellaneous tasks and duties in support of GSO Property section operations i.e., incidental driving duties to transport appliances, equipment and furnishings to and from warehouse stores, work sites, offices and other locations as may be assigned by non-expendable storekeeper.
  • Moves, loads and unload supplies, appliances and equipment to/from warehouse to offices and residential quarters.
  • Assists with basic house furnishing in support of GSO warehouse men during busy house make ready schedules and, skilled trades’ workers by carrying, holding, lifting, moving tools and materials.
  • Uses hand trucks, forklifts, wheelbarrows, and simple hand tools required for warehouse operations.
  • Advises Non-expendable storekeeper on equipment procurement processes by providing technical guidance on the correct specifications, quality and type as requested in reference to rating, authenticity, and safety requirements.
  • Assists with local BPA procurements of essential repair supplies, basic tools/equipment, maintains replacement parts supplies, tools and equipment in safe working condition including general housekeeping of shop, office work sites and warehouse storage areas.

Qualifications, Skills and Experience:

  • Completion of secondary school (O & A level) and vocational training or apprenticeship recognized as producing electrician skills is required.
  • Three years’ experience in appliance repair and installation/electrical work is required.
  • Must have full electrician knowledge of established practices, handling of appliances/equipment and procedures of the electrical trade.
  • Must have the ability to use all mechanical and electrical tools/equipment professionally to determine extent of damage and experience to make necessary recommendations for equipment repair or replacement.
  • Must hold valid Class B Ugandan driver’s license.
  • Must have computer skills i.e., knowledge in Excel, Microsoft word, outlook etc.
  • Level III (Good working knowledge) English, both spoken and written is required. Level III (Good working knowledge) Luganda both spoken and written is required.
